Protective structures of central nervous system
Write down the protective structures of central nervous system present in the vertebrates?
Expert
In vertebrates the brain and spinal cord are protected by the membranes, the meninges, and by the osseous structures, respectively skull and vertebral column. These protections are fundamental for the integrity of those significant organs which command the functioning of body.
